The Center for Pediatric Sleep Apnea Orthodontics

At every stage of life, a good night’s sleep is essential to one’s overall health and well-being. Although sleep-related breathing disorders, including obstructive sleep apnea, can occur at any age, these conditions can have a profound impact on a child’s quality of life.

At The Center for Pediatric Sleep Apnea Orthodontics in Indianapolis, our doctors are experts in all aspects of facial growth and development. We understand the complex relationship between craniofacial anatomy and airway function and how it contributes to both orthodontic and sleep apnea issues. By working closely with Pediatric Sleep Medicine specialists, ENTs, and Primary Care Physicians, we can identify and help address obstructive sleep apnea while treating orthodontic problems to improve a child’s overall wellness.
